Calculated using a safety factor (K) of 2
 
 Equation:
 Pg = [ Cf * B * d * Ys * pi ] / K
 = [ (1.2) * (0.688 in.) * (0.022 in.) * (45,000 psi) * 3.14 ] / 2
 | 1,283 |  | lbs. |  |  |  | (Pr) Theoretical Thrust Load Capacity - Ring Shear: Notes: Ring Material: Carbon Spring Steel (SAE 1060-1090). Shear Strength of Ring Material (Ss): 150,000 psi. Calculated using a safety factor (K) of 4
 
 Equation:
 Pr = [ Cf * B * t * Ss * pi ] / K
 = [ (1.2) * (0.688 in.) * (0.035 in.) * (150,000 psi) * 3.14 ] / 4
 | 3,402 |  | lbs. |  |  |  | Industry Equivalent Part Number(s): NJW68, 3001-X68, N1301-68, BHO-68, 5001-068, 5001-68
